Spotsaas Editor’s POV
MuleSoft Anypoint Platform is a centralized environment for API design, management, and integration. The platform consolidates these functions in a single interface, which reduces the need to switch between tools. MuleSoft Anypoint Platform pros and cons
Extensive connector library covers a wide range of vendor systems.
Interface is clean and customer support is accessible.
Includes tools for building APIs, integrating systems, and managing applications.
Enables fast and secure communication between different platforms and technologies.
Steep learning curve for those new to integration work.
High pricing can be a barrier for small to medium-sized businesses.
